SSANZ Round North Island: Images from start of Leg 2

by Sail-World.com/nz 26 Feb 2020 01:45 PST 26 February 2020
Start Leg 2 - Evolution Sails - Round North Island Race 2020 - Mongonui, Northland NZ - February 2020 © Deb Williams

Deb Williams was on hand for the start of Leg 2 of the Evolution Sails Round North Island Race at Mongonui on Monday, and filed these images.
